It is primarily treated with endovascular therapy. However, transvenous or transarterial endovascular access may be difficult in some cases and may fail to obliterate the fistula. We describe the first case of utilizing the endoscopic transorbital approach (ETOA) to directly obliterating the CCF. Case Description: A 65-year-old man presented with the left eye blurring of vision for 2 months. He was diagnosed with the left Barrow type D indirect CCF with cortical venous reflux on digital subtraction angiogram. Primary transvenous embolization failed due to thrombosed venous access. Thus, we employed ETOA through a lid crease incision, lateral orbitotomy, and drilling of the sphenoid wing to access the cavernous sinus. Direct cannulation of the cavernous sinus was attempted. Ultimately, we injected hemostatic agents including Floseal to directly obliterate the CCF. Postoperative and follow-up digital subtraction angiogram showed complete obliteration. This is the first case of endoscopic-assisted transorbital approach to direct obliteration of a CCF. This approach allows for a smaller wound, less morbidity for complex cases with difficult venous access, with potential for complete obliteration. Conclusion: We illustrate the novel use of ETOA to direct obliteration of a complex CCF.","thumbnailUrl":"https://sni-digital-videos.s3.amazonaws.com/articles/23d46952-d1e8-4b5d-ab43-483ecc41c8a1/featured/hero-1781558081123.png","publishDate":"2025-12-19T00:00:00.000Z","doi":"10.25259/SNI_938_2025","categories":["Neurovascular","Case Report"],"fullTextUrl":"https://surgicalneurologyint.com/wp-content/uploads/2025/12/14170/SNI-16-532.pdf"}
